It's possible :) Just VERY hard. No torque on the jet so a V stab isn't completely essential.
Twice I've flipped out and augered after getting my V stab removed. The third time I happened to be afk and came back to find me flying level on auto pilot with no V stab. I had it removed by a spray and pray pony on reviewing the film. Knowing that it'd fly level I checked around for a base directly off my nose. There was one 100 miles away so rather than risk the turn to a nearer base I left it on auto and headed for that one. Slow slow turns and a very gradual rate of decent and I managed to coax it down to the deck and flying at lowish speed. dropped the gear and landed a fair way from the field but it was a landing :) taxied back and voila! landed spectacularly succesfully.

You can control the the plane by adjusting the the engine throttles seprately. Even without a V-Stab it will work somewhat like a rudder .. just don't over do it.
i.e. I have mine setup with A-S-D on keyboard (since I don't have a cool dual throttle like Tac :) )
A- selects left engine for thorottle control
S- selects all engines for control
D- selects right engine
this can be helpful in any twin engined plane :D
